哈希游戏公开吗哈希游戏公开吗

哈希游戏公开吗哈希游戏公开吗,

本文目录导读:

  1. 哈希游戏的定义与背景
  2. 哈希游戏的公开性探讨
  3. 哈希游戏的未来发展

哈希函数,作为现代密码学的重要组成部分,以其独特的数学性质和强大的抗攻击能力,成为保障数据安全的核心技术,哈希游戏作为一种利用哈希函数进行的互动娱乐形式,其公开性问题却引发了广泛的讨论,本文将从多个角度探讨哈希游戏的公开性,揭示其背后的技术原理和现实意义。

哈希游戏的定义与背景

哈希游戏是一种基于哈希函数的互动娱乐形式,玩家通过输入特定的明文,生成对应的哈希值,完成游戏任务,这种游戏形式不仅考验玩家的计算能力,还要求玩家具备一定的密码学知识,随着计算机技术的发展,哈希游戏逐渐成为密码学教育和普及的重要工具。

哈希函数的核心特性决定了其在游戏中的应用,哈希函数具有单向性,即从哈希值反推明文几乎是不可能的,哈希函数对任何明文的改变都会导致哈希值的显著变化,这种特性使得哈希函数成为检测数据完整性的重要工具。

哈希游戏的公开性探讨

公开哈希表的漏洞

在哈希游戏的常见形式中,玩家通常需要公开哈希表,即明文与哈希值之间的对应关系,这种公开行为看似便利,实则存在严重的安全隐患,生日攻击就是一种利用哈希表漏洞进行的攻击方式,通过精心选择的明文对,可以快速找到具有相同哈希值的明文,从而实现信息的伪造或篡改。

哈希表的公开还可能导致信息泄露,如果哈希表中的明文与敏感信息相关,那么泄露哈希表就相当于泄露了大量敏感数据,这种风险在密码学中被称为"已知明文攻击",其危害不容小觑。

公开哈希函数的强度

哈希函数的强度直接关系到哈希游戏的安全性,在现实应用中,哈希函数通常采用双层哈希机制,即先对明文进行一次哈希,再对哈希值进行第二次哈希,这种机制可以有效防止暴力攻击,如暴力破解哈希表。

哈希函数的强度并不等同于其安全性,MD5和SHA-1等传统哈希函数已经被证明存在已知攻击,其强度远低于预期,这些攻击手段的出现,使得公开哈希函数的强度成为一种潜在的威胁。

公开哈希的应用与影响

哈希游戏的公开性问题不仅涉及技术层面,还关系到教育和普及的广泛性,通过公开哈希表或哈希函数,玩家可以更直观地理解哈希函数的工作原理,从而提高其安全意识。

这种公开也带来了潜在的风险,如果哈希游戏被滥用,可能会被用于进行恶意攻击,某些游戏可能存在漏洞,玩家通过公开哈希表或哈希函数,可以快速破解游戏的密钥,从而获取不法利益。

哈希游戏的未来发展

面对哈希游戏的公开性问题,未来的发展方向需要在技术与教育之间找到平衡点,哈希游戏应该具备较高的安全性,防止漏洞的利用,哈希游戏的应用场景应该更加明确,避免被滥用。

密码学教育也应该更加注重理论与实践的结合,通过设计更加安全的哈希游戏,玩家可以在娱乐中学习,同时提高其安全意识。

哈希游戏的公开性问题是一个复杂而重要的议题,从技术角度来看,哈希函数的单向性和抗攻击性是其安全的基础,哈希游戏的公开行为却可能带来严重的安全隐患,未来的哈希游戏发展,需要在技术与教育之间找到平衡点,确保其安全性和教育意义,哈希游戏才能真正成为密码学教育的重要工具,而不是成为不法分子的工具。

哈希游戏公开吗哈希游戏公开吗,

发表评论